A Legal Guide to Bicycle Accidents

Bicyclists often share the road with much larger vehicles, which puts them at increased risk for severe injuries. Some common causes of bicycle accidents often include: 

  • Driver negligence 

  • Failure to yield at intersections 

  • Distracted driving 

  • Speeding 

  • Poor road conditions 

  • Vehicle blind spots 

When a bicycle accident occurs, victims often suffer from injuries such as traumatic brain injuries, spinal cord injuries, fractures, and lacerations. These injuries can lead to extended medical treatments, rehabilitation, and in some cases, even permanent disability.

Kentucky Bicycle Accident Laws

Understanding Kentucky’s specific laws regarding bicycle accidents is necessary to build a strong case. In Kentucky, bicyclists have a right to the road and must adhere to the same traffic laws as motor vehicles. The key regulations include: 

  • Helmet laws: While Kentucky does not have a statewide helmet law for bicyclists, local ordinances may require helmets, particularly for minors. 

  • Lane positioning: Bicyclists are required to ride as far to the right as practicable, but they may take the full lane if it is too narrow for a bicycle and a vehicle to share safely. 

  • Bicycle equipment: Bicycles used at night must have a front white light visible from at least 500 feet and a rear red reflector visible from 50 to 300 feet. 

  • Right-of-way: Bicyclists must provide the right-of-way to pedestrians and follow all traffic signals and signs. 

Violations of these laws by either party can significantly impact the outcome of a bicycle accident case. Your attorney should be familiar with these statutes for effective legal representation. 

What to Do After a Bicycle Accident

In the aftermath of a bicycle accident, there are specific steps you can take to protect your rights and well-being. Here’s a quick round-up: 

  1. Ensure safety and seek medical attention: Move to a safe place and check for injuries. Even if you feel fine, it's essential to seek medical attention since some injuries might not be immediately apparent. 

  2. Call the police: Report the accident to the police, and make sure an official report is filed. This report will be important for any legal proceedings or insurance claims. 

  3. Gather evidence: Collect as much evidence from the scene as possible. Take photographs of your bike, the vehicle(s) involved, road conditions, and any visible injuries. If there are witnesses, obtain their contact information as well. 

  4. Exchange information: Obtain the driver's name, contact details, insurance information, and vehicle registration number. 

  5. Preserve your damaged bike and gear: Do not repair your bike or replace damaged equipment before consulting an attorney. These items are important evidence. 

  6. Document everything: Keep detailed records of your medical treatments, doctor visits, and any communication with insurance companies.
